- Coba_Coba abstract "Coba Coba is the third album from the Peruvian band, Novalima. The 2009 release, off U.S. based, independent label, Cumbancha further explores the African roots of Afro-Peruvian music. The band implores the use of various genres, reggae, dub, salsa, afro-beat, to create their sound.Coba Coba stays true to its traditional roots, while simultaneously pushing the boundaries; \"Most people still think Peru is only panpipes,\" says guitarist/keyboardist Rafael Morales. \"This is our interpretation of traditional Afro-Peruvian music, forward-thinking but without losing the soul and tribal rhythms of its roots.\" The sound is cutting edge, but traces its roots back to the times of Spanish Colonial rule and slavery.".
